I was curious if it was illegal as well but after looking into it

"Certain entities are except from the restrictions of the Telemarketing Sales Rule (aka “TSR,” “the Rule” or “the Do Not Call list”), the restrictions on prerecorded calls, or both. These include certain prerecorded healthcare messages and some prerecorded messages placed on behalf of a non-profit charitable organization to previous donors. A blanket exemption is held by political organizations, telephone surveyors, and companies that have an existing business relationship with the recipient."

I'm guessing applying for their airline once 4 years ago must be their rationale

I'll save you guys the trouble of calling back:

They are hiring in to the CRJ7 (ord) and the E175 (dfw)

They are estimating roughly 300 captains per year will flow to AA

Roughly another 150 pilots leaves to other carriers per year.

With currently 1800 people on property that translates to about 6 years for flow to AA

1.5 years projected reserve.

2.5 years to upgrade

The bonus is handed to you on date of hire in one lump sum with the taxes already withheld from the check (roughly $10K after taxes)

Is that worth it for you to start at the bottom again? I dunno. Your mileage may vary!
